Rhode Island State Survey of 750 Likely Voters
Conducted October 4, 2010
By Rasmussen Reports

 

1* If the 2010 election for Governor of Rhode Island were held today would you vote for Republican John Robitaille, Democrat Frank Caprio, Independent Lincoln Chafee or Moderate party candidate Ken Block?

 

22% Robitaille

30% Caprio

  33% Chafee

  4% Block

10% Not sure
